  • Abstract
    New expressions are derived for the fringe current components of the equivalent edge currents. They are obtained by asymptotic endpoint evaluation of the fringe current radiation integral over the "ray coordinate" measured along the diffracted ray grazing the surface of the local wedge. The resulting expressions, unlike the previous ones, are finite for all aspects of illumination and observation, except for the special case where the direction of observation is the continuation of a glancing incident ray propagating "inwards" with respect to the wedge surface (the Ufimtsev singularity).
